Introducing Sensory Exploration of Taste, Touch, Sight, Sound and Smell 

COSTA RICA – Luxury wellness boutique resort The Retreat Costa Rica perched on a high vibrational crystal mountain in Atenas has created a “Five Senses” package to celebrate its fifth anniversary on May 1. The five-night package is available throughout 2021 and is fully packed with on-site activities to stimulate the senses. In addition to the special revitalizing and exciting experiences included in this new package, guests will enjoy the new enhancements The Retreat Costa Rica made during the recent border closure.

Five Senses Package

Reconnecting with nature and stimulating all its sensual glories, this package delivers six days/five nights filled with awakening and satisfying the five senses. Taste: guests can taste delicious and healthy cuisine while learning to prepare it. Touch: visitors will experience the magnificence of The Retreat Costa Rica’s healing crystal scrub spa treatments. Sight: Seeing beyond the colorful natural surroundings and wildlife and immersing in a Chromotherapy Mineral Bath encourage guests to absorb the healing properties of color. Sound: bath treatments that ignite the cells to dance and reorganize parasympathetic nerves will promote calm and peace. Smell: organic teas can be sampled at a unique rare tea tasting event with the resort’s executive chef.

Guests are now greeted on arrival at the new “Crystal Room” with its healing energy. Guestrooms are refreshed with new paint, furnishings, décor and enhanced patios. The signature pool now has a 1,000-square-foot deck near the mountain’s edge with new deck furniture, and a pergola has been added. There’s also a new curtain pavilion with new outdoor seating at the Yoga House. The Retreat has added a conference room, as well as the Galana Boutique filled with global special finds.

Importantly, as travel to The Retreat has been certified by the Costa Rica Health Ministry for meeting COVID-19 guidelines, the resort ensures the safety and wellness of all its guests and employees with safety protocols and access to COVID-19 PCR and rapid testing.
